- Como faço para espelhar um repositório GitLab?
- Como faço para espelhar um repositório?
- Como faço para espelhar um repositório GitHub?
- O que é espelhamento no GitLab?
- O que é git clone bare?
- O que significa espelhar um repositório?
- Como faço para duplicar um repositório?
- Qual é a diferença entre git pull e git fetch?
- O que é espelho push?
- Como faço para manter dois repositórios GIT sincronizados?
- Como faço para enviar um repositório clonado para outro?
- Como faço para enviar código para o laboratório git?
Como faço para espelhar um repositório GitLab?
Para um projeto existente, você pode configurar o espelhamento push da seguinte maneira:
- Navegue até as configurações do seu projeto > Repositório e expanda a seção Repositórios de espelhamento.
- Insira um URL de repositório.
- Selecione Push no menu suspenso Mirror direction.
- Selecione um método de autenticação no menu suspenso Método de autenticação, se necessário.
Como faço para espelhar um repositório?
Você primeiro precisa obter o repositório Git original em sua máquina. Então, vá para o repositório. Finalmente, use a sinalização --mirror para copiar tudo em seu repositório Git local para o novo repo.
Como faço para espelhar um repositório GitHub?
Navegue até o repositório que você acabou de clonar. Puxe os objetos Git Large File Storage do repositório. Mirror-push para o novo repositório. Envie os objetos Git Large File Storage do repositório para o seu espelho.
O que é espelhamento no GitLab?
O espelhamento de repositório é uma maneira de espelhar repositórios de fontes externas. Ele pode ser usado para espelhar todos os branches, tags e commits que você tem em seu repositório. Seu espelho no GitLab será atualizado automaticamente. Você também pode acionar manualmente uma atualização no máximo uma vez a cada 5 minutos.
O que é git clone bare?
git clone --bare
Semelhante a git init --bare, quando o argumento -bare é passado para git clone, uma cópia do repositório remoto será feita com um diretório de trabalho omitido. Isso significa que um repositório será configurado com o histórico do projeto que pode ser empurrado e retirado, mas não pode ser editado diretamente.
O que significa espelhar um repositório?
O espelhamento de repositório é uma maneira de espelhar repositórios de fontes externas. Ele pode ser usado para espelhar todos os branches, tags e commits que você tem em seu repositório. Seu espelho no GitLab será atualizado automaticamente. Você também pode acionar manualmente uma atualização no máximo uma vez a cada 5 minutos.
Como faço para duplicar um repositório?
Para clonar seu repositório Github no Windows.
- Abra o Git Bash. Se o Git ainda não estiver instalado, é super simples. ...
- Vá para o diretório atual onde deseja que o diretório clonado seja adicionado. ...
- Vá para a página do repositório que você deseja clonar.
- Clique em “Clonar ou baixar” e copie o URL.
Qual é a diferença entre git pull e git fetch?
git fetchéo comando que diz ao seu git local para recuperar as últimas informações de meta-dados do original (mas não faz nenhuma transferência de arquivo. É mais como apenas verificar se há alguma alteração disponível). git pull, por outro lado, faz isso E traz (copia) essas mudanças do repositório remoto.
O que é espelho push?
Além de seus branches locais, ele também empurra seus branches remotos, porque espelho implica em tudo. Então, quando você empurra normalmente (ou com --mirror), mybranch é empurrado e origin / mybranch é atualizado para refletir o novo status na origem. Quando você empurra com --mirror, origin / mybranch também é empurrado.
Como faço para manter dois repositórios GIT sincronizados?
Como sincronizar dois repositórios Git remotos.
- Abra o terminal e mude o diretório de trabalho atual para o seu projeto local.
- Liste o repositório remoto configurado atualmente para o seu fork. ...
- Especifique um novo repositório upstream remoto que será sincronizado com o fork. ...
- Verifique o novo repositório upstream que você especificou para sua bifurcação.
Como faço para enviar um repositório clonado para outro?
Excluir git e reinicializar.
- vá para sua pasta de repositório clonada rm -rf .idiota.
- reinicialize-o e, em seguida, adicione seu controle remoto e faça seu primeiro push. git init git add . git commit -m "sua mensagem de confirmação" git remote add origin git push origin master.
Como faço para enviar código para o laboratório git?
Nas etapas a seguir, configuraremos nosso repositório e enviaremos o código para ele:
- Vá para o repositório recém-criado.
- Selecione o URL na seção superior direita.
- Vá para a pasta onde deseja verificar o projeto no terminal. ...
- Digite o comando Git clone e altere o URL para o URL que você acabou de copiar: